Senior Software Engineering Manager

Senior Software Engineering Manager

Contract ¦¦ Onsite ¦¦ Dublin City

TechHeads is currently seeking a Senior Software Engineering Manager for an onsite Contract position for an initial 6 month assignment (rolling for 2 years). The successful candidate will be responsible for leading and overseeing the design, development, testing and deployment of our Client’s software applications.

The successful candidate will have responsibility for all stages of the SDLC and for ensuring all processes are as efficient and performant as possible. You will liaise across Technical leadership and stakeholders across business units to ensure alignment of priorities, budgets and deliveries.  As a senior tech member of staff, you will be responsible for the delivery of robust, modern solutions to the highest standards within tight timeframes.

Responsibilities:

  • Work closely with the application Product Owners to align resources and priorities
  • Work closely with the Senior Technical Architects to ensure the highest standard of development designs are applied
  • Act as the quality gate on all Releases
  • You will lead the prioritisation & implementation of all application delivery to meet business and client services levels
  • You will drive a culture of constant improvement, ensuring best-practices and industry standards are adopted in all phases of the SDLC
  • Standardise development and deployment practices across all applications.
  • You will manage the interface between Business Applications, IT Stakeholders, Infrastructure teams and business units to ensure daily operations run smoothly.
  • You will develop & maintain excellent relationships with clients & internal and external suppliers and service providers to maintain cost-effective service levels.
  • You will closely support a well-designed and robust IT Infrastructure to support the business application needs.
  • Reporting on operational KPIs and SLAs covering all aspects of Software Development
  • Maintain and manage a knowledge base & document stores to capture key learnings.
  • Align closely with the CTO, Head of Infrastructure, Head of IT Operations working to support all aspects of infrastructure design, changes, development, implementation, and support
  • Strong awareness of building software in a high compliance environment, including factoring in SOX, DORA, GDPR requirements in process and development
  • Close working with PMO function to coordinate and schedule programmes of work, prioritisation and sequencing
  • You will develop, maintain and present an annual IT Software Delivery Strategy to senior stakeholders

Requirements

  • 10+ years’ experience managing IT Development and QA Teams Systems in a large-scale hybrid (on-prem, Cloud), fast paced environment in a sector with strong compliance and regulatory oversight.
  • Experience managing an IT Change Program with a focus on quality, efficiency and cost-reduction
  • Strong experience of managing across multiple disciplines within a large IT department, balancing resources and ensuring resource and skillset alignment.
  • Previous experience delivering Automation initiatives within an established SDLC
  • Experience of migrating on-prem Services and Applications to Azure cloud
  • Strong experience of Release and Deployment management
  • Strong experience of Program management and reporting to C-level stakeholders.
  • Professionally presented with excellent customer-facing skills, and the ability to build and maintain working relationships with customers at all levels.
  • Leadership ability with the desire to constantly improve.
Apply Now

To apply for this job email your details to eoin@techheads.ie